Hinduism Family

Hinduism is the name given for the majority religion of India. There is no central authority in Hinduism, although most Hindu groups and traditions believe in reincarnation and venerate gods and goddesses who are viewed as manifestations of God. Sanskrit texts known as Vedas are sacred scriptures in Hinduism and were composed between 1200 and 900 BCE. Major traditions within Hinduism include Vaishnavism, which is devoted to worship of the god Vishnu, and Shaivism, organized around worship of the god Shiva. Following the passage of the 1965 Immigration and Nationality Act, which allowed for more immigration from India, the Hindu population has grown rapidly in the U.S.

Top 5 Hinduism Family States (2020)1 [View all states]

Rank State Adherents Adherence Rate
1 Delaware 12,731 12.90
2 New Jersey 102,132 11.00
3 New York 105,668 5.20
4 Maryland 31,230 5.10
5 Nebraska 9,000 4.60
       

Top 5 Hinduism Family Counties (2020)1 [View all counties]

Rank County Adherents Adherence Rate
1 Clayton County, Georgia 21,000 70.60
2 Salem city, Virginia 1,731 68.30
3 Morris County, New Jersey 23,750 46.60
4 Atlantic County, New Jersey 11,731 42.70
5 Somerset County, New Jersey 14,500 42.00
